War Memorial Opera House: A Beaux-Arts Masterpiece

4.8 (2216)

Home to the San Francisco Opera and Ballet, this Beaux-Arts landmark offers world-class performances and a glimpse into history.

The War Memorial Opera House in San Francisco, a Beaux-Arts architectural gem, has been the home of the San Francisco Opera since 1932 and the San Francisco Ballet since 1933. It also hosted the first assembly of the United Nations in 1945 and the ceremony where the U.S. restored Japanese sovereignty in 1951.

Getting There

  • Public Transport

    The War Memorial Opera House is easily accessible via public transportation. From the Civic Center BART and MUNI stations, it's a short walk. Take the BART to the Civic Center/UN Plaza station. Several MUNI lines also serve the area. A single ride on MUNI costs $2.50. Consider purchasing a day pass if you plan to use public transport extensively.

  • Walking

    From the Civic Center BART and MUNI stations, the War Memorial Opera House is a 5-10 minute walk. Head west on Grove Street towards Van Ness Avenue. The Opera House will be on your left, across from City Hall.

  • Taxi/Ride-share

    Taxi and ride-sharing services can drop you off directly in front of the Opera House at 301 Van Ness Avenue. A short ride from the Caltrain station will cost approximately $12-15. Be aware that traffic can be heavy in the Civic Center area, especially during performances.

Discover more about War Memorial Opera House

Located in San Francisco's Civic Center, the War Memorial Opera House stands as a monument to the city's vibrant arts scene and a tribute to those who served in World War I. Designed by Arthur Brown Jr. and G. Albert Lansburgh, the 3,146-seat theater opened in 1932 and is one of the last Beaux-Arts structures built in the United States. Its architecture features a classic Roman Doric order, inspired by the Louvre Colonnade. Inside, visitors are greeted by a grand lobby with a 38-foot ceiling and ornate fixtures. The main hall boasts a high barrel-vaulted and coffered ceiling, plush velvet seats, and state-of-the-art technology. The Opera House has undergone renovations, including a seismic retrofit in 1997, to ensure its preservation for future generations. Beyond its architectural beauty, the War Memorial Opera House holds a significant place in history. In 1945, it hosted the first assembly of the newly formed United Nations, and in 1951, it was the site of the ceremony where the United States restored Japanese sovereignty. Today, the Opera House continues to host world-class opera and ballet performances, as well as other events.
